Output 89af3fca5ce8dab0842c43d37c5dae3c55e111b442b2190ed588514a6c7ba4ac:0

value
74089
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b89514c6a5abc52e0348ca1d86fc8afe36ea3693 OP_EQUALVERIFY OP_CHECKSIG
address
1HpyvdxGN9kRTpe8uhEWpuCDa2C8KYwpZ1
transaction
89af3fca5ce8dab0842c43d37c5dae3c55e111b442b2190ed588514a6c7ba4ac
spent
true